Acetaminophen Formulation With Protection Against Toxic Effects of Overdose
20230218552 · 2023-07-13 ·

An oral pharmaceutical dosage form that comprises both acetaminophen and a glutathione replenishing agent, such as N-acetylcysteine. This allows co-administering the glutathione replenishing agent along with acetaminophen, which may be beneficial in rapidly counteracting the toxic effects of acetaminophen overdose. The oral dosage form could be in the form of a tablet or capsule. The dosage form may be designed to compartmentally separate the glutathione replenishing agent from having chemical interaction with the acetaminophen. The dosage form may be designed to mask the taste or smell of the glutathione replenishing agent.

CONTROLLED-RELEASE TABLET OF IBUPROFEN AND METHOD FOR PREPARING SAME

An ibuprofen controlled-release tablet and a method for preparing same are provided. The controlled-release tablet is composed of a drug-containing immediate-release layer and a drug-containing sustained-release layer, wherein a mass of ibuprofen in the drug-containing sustained-release layer is greater than a mass of ibuprofen in the drug-containing immediate-release layer, and a ratio of the mass of the ibuprofen in the drug-containing sustained-release layer to the mass of the ibuprofen in the drug-containing immediate-release layer is ≤7. The tablet of the present disclosure has an effective analgesic effect for 24 h after administration.

ORAL TABLETS COMPRISING ROLLER-COMPACTED GRANULES OF NAPROXEN SODIUM, METHODS OF PREPARING THEREOF, AND METHODS OF USING THEREOF

The present disclosure relates to oral naproxen sodium tablets comprising roller-compacted granules, methods of preparing thereof, and methods of using thereof. The naproxen sodium tablets are formulated for and prepared by dry granulation methods, specifically roller compaction. The combination of dry granulation compatible excipients with roller compaction methods results m naproxen sodium tablets that exhibit an enhanced dissolution profile and shorter disintegration time as compared to commercially available oral naproxen sodium tablets prepared by standard wet granulation methods.

Encased tamper resistant controlled release dosage forms
11590082 · 2023-02-28 · ·

In certain embodiments, the present invention is directed to a solid controlled release dosage form comprising: a core comprising a first portion of an opioid analgesic dispersed in a first matrix material; and a shell encasing the core and comprising a second portion of the opioid analgesic dispersed in a second matrix material; wherein the amount of opioid analgesic released from the dosage form is proportional within 20% to elapsed time from 8 to 24 hours, as measured by an in-vitro dissolution in a USP Apparatus 1 (basket) at 100 rpm in 900 ml simulated gastric fluid without enzymes (SGF) at 37 C.

PHARMACEUTICAL COMPOSITE FORMULATION COMPRISING PROTON PUMP INHIBITOR AND ANTACID

An aspect provides a pharmaceutical composite formulation containing: a first layer comprising a proton pump inhibitor or a pharmaceutically acceptable salt thereof as an active ingredient, a disintegrant, and a binder; and a second layer comprising, as an active ingredient, an antacid selected from magnesium hydroxide, magnesium oxide, or a mixture thereof.
